SPOK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2017 in Review

117 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Spok Holdings (SPOK) for Q2 2017, worth a combined $309M — down 9.4% from $341M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 18 funds closed out of SPOK and 11 opened new positions — a net loss of 7 holders — while 47 trimmed existing stakes and 35 added.

The largest buyer was Numeric Investors, adding an estimated $3.04M. The largest seller was LSV Asset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$3.73M sold.
